Size
Capacity and power are the biggest differences within the microwaves on the market today. Before you search around, it's a good idea to determine what capacity and power your family needs.
Power
You need to buy a microwave oven that is a higher powered if you plan to use your microwave to cook a lot of food for a large number of people. Look for the microwave by having a wattage of at least 1000 watts. Compact microwave ovens operate between 500-800 watts, midsize microwave oven ovens tend to vary from 800-1000 watts, and full size microwaves are over 1000 watts. The higher the wattage, the more power the microwave has, which means faster cooking times.
The capacity of a microwave is almost as crucial as the power. You want to make sure that you get a microwave that is big sufficient to suit your favorite cookware. If you are intending to prepare large casseroles in your microwave, you should look at buying a full size model. Compact microwave ovens have a capacity that is usually less than .8 cubic feet. Midsize microwave ovens have a capacity that is .8 to 1.2 cubic feet and full size microwaves are larger than 1.2 cubic feet.
Kitchen Space
The very last thing to consider whenever buying a microwave oven is storage space. How big is the microwave will limit where you could place it, so it needs to be taken under consideration. For those who have limited counter space, a full size microwave can be out of the question. If you are set on getting a high wattage microwave oven with the ability to prepare a roast, but your countertop area is limited, there are a couple of options. You should buy a microwave cart to place it on or choose a microwave oven that fits over your current range. You can also find microwaves that fit under cabinets or built in to your walls.
